A Christchurch street has reopened following a gas leak.

Emergency services were called to the incident at 2.20pm on Monday after reports that a gas main had been hit.

Motorists were asked to avoid the area between Bealey Ave and Salisbury St. 

Fire and Emergency New Zealand spokesman Darryl Ball said no evacuations were required. 

A police spokeswoman later confirmed the street had been reopened later in the afternoon.
